Dean Herman Dack age 94, of Mc-Cook passed away at the Community Hospital of McCook on Saturday, November 12, 2022. He was born in McCook on October 20, 1928, to Joseph E. and Maude C.

(Tubbs) Dack. He loved country life and raising livestock. He joined the U. S. Army in January of 1951, serving as a member of the 456th Field Artillery Unit during the Korean War. He was stationed in Germany until December 19, 1952, when he was Honorably Discharged. Upon his return, Dean continued farming with his brothers and began working at the Red Willow County ASCS office.

On February 16,1964 he was united in marriage to Vera Schwab at the Methodist Church in Lyle, KS. Together they worked their farm Northwest of Indianola, NE, where they raised their two daughters.

He was also a seed salesman for P.A.G. and then Cargill. He served 9 years on the Red Willow ASCS county committee and 8 years on the McCook Public Power Board. Dean “retired” in 1999, and he and Vera moved to McCook, NE.

Dean’s favorite past times were spending time with his family, visiting with friends at the sale barn on sale days, playing pool, hunting and rooting for the Dodgers and the Huskers.
